    "We've seen touch-friendly tables before, but they're rarely so slick as the Multi Surface Experience, a newly launched collaboration between design firm Gensler and ad agency The Hive. The installation lets guests explore Gensler's architectural portfolio (the book you see above) just by walking up to a wavy table. An overhead projector, Kinect for Windows and special software present an interface wherever people stand; when users choose to learn more about a project, it pops up on a wall-mounted 4K display."

Twitter, Hollywood Working on In-Stream Video Series | Adweek - 0 views

  •  
    And the talk is more than just about launching a Web show. Rather, Twitter is said to be aiming towards changing the way people consume and discover media. "We're talking about building content on top of Twitter," said another industry insider. "That's a big deal." Twitter wouldn't be developing the content, but would instead serve as a distribution vehicle and advertising middleman. Besides looking to shake up the media space, Twitter has a more obvious motivation for getting into the series game. It regularly sells out of inventory for its core ad units like Promoted Tweets. "Right now, they are leaving money on the table," said one source.
